Voltage Compatibility Requirements

Understanding Voltage Compatibility Requirements is essential for selecting the right charger for your RC truck. Different RC trucks require specific voltage levels; for example, many small models operate on 3.7V batteries, while larger models typically use 7.4V or 11.1V. It’s imperative to match the charger voltage to your battery voltage to avoid damage; using a 7.4V charger on a 3.7V battery can lead to overcharging. Always check your truck’s battery specifications, ensuring that the charger supports the correct voltage for safe and efficient charging. Additionally, many chargers cover a specific range of battery capacities, like 500mAh to 1500mAh for 7.4V batteries, which impacts how quickly your truck’s battery charges.

Connector Types Availability

Connector Types play an essential role in ensuring compatibility between your RC truck charger and its battery. Common options include SM-2P, SM-3P, and XH-3P, each tailored for specific battery types. The SM-2P connector is typically used for 3.7V Li-ion or Li-Po batteries, while the XH-3P connector suits 7.4V configurations in various RC trucks and boats. Selecting a charger with the correct connector type guarantees secure connections, preventing potential battery damage. Additionally, SM-4P connectors are versatile, accommodating multiple battery sizes, enhancing usability. It’s vital to verify that your charger’s connector matches your RC truck’s battery type, ensuring effective charging and avoiding inconvenient issues during operation. Is It Safe to Leave My RC Truck Charger Plugged In?

It’s not safe to leave your RC truck charger plugged in after charging. Overheating Risk: Chargers can generate heat, potentially damaging the battery or charger. Battery Degradation: Leaving it connected over time can reduce battery lifespan, causing long-term performance issues. Fire Hazard: Continuous power can lead to electrical faults, increasing fire risk. To guarantee safety, unplug the charger once the battery reaches full charge, maintaining both functionality and safety for longer usage.
